Output 61b71cda4a3cf094f26580476345abb2cfe561aadce2213b5ff7012073a5c81b:0

value
65622006
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38e3115565fad80d34a938024a30436a852ae036 OP_EQUAL
address
36sonE8rayzQymSB3zs1wohFtan6k2kVD7
transaction
61b71cda4a3cf094f26580476345abb2cfe561aadce2213b5ff7012073a5c81b
spent
true